**TICKET-4412: Expired creds blocking cold storage archival**

Heads up for the sync: the archival job for the Glacierbird cold storage buckets has been failing since Tuesday because the service creds expired. Nothing's lost, just stuck in staging. Priya minted a fresh key for the archiver this morning. Use the one below for now.

API key for yahig-tadup: kto7_ubizbYm

## Configuration

The Quartzloop resolver batching layer eliminates the N+1 query pattern in our GraphQL tier by coalescing lookups through the Hearthcache dataloader. For review purposes: batching is enabled via `QL_BATCH_ENABLED`, and batch windows are tuned with `QL_BATCH_WINDOW_MS`. The dataloader authenticates to Hearthcache with a credential stored only in the deployment environment, declared on the line below.

secret setting of kawif-haweg: COURIER_KEY8=0cf7bc02

## Runbook: FD Leak Hunt — Pillarjay Gateway

Symptoms: descriptor count climbs ~40/min under load. Steps: snapshot lsof output, diff against baseline, restart only the affected shard. Do not roll the whole fleet. Patched builds close sockets on timeout, confirmed in staging. Ship the hotfix through the usual pipeline; staging and prod both verify artifacts before swap. Sign the hotfix bundle with the key below.

deploy key for hawef-bafog: bky13_1N9K4SjjejvXh

// HOT_RELOAD_DEBOUNCE_MS sets the quiet period the Corvid host waits
// after detecting a config file change before reloading plugin settings.
// Plugin authors: your onConfigReload hook fires at most once per
// debounce window, and you receive the merged config, not a diff.
// Writes made during the window coalesce. Do not block inside the
// hook; long handlers delay every plugin. Verified against the build
// stamped below.

trace token, fafog-kageg: htk4_98e6

**Vendor note: Inkmill markdown pipeline**

Rendering for Parchway docs is outsourced to Inkmill under an annual contract, renewing each March. They handle sanitization and PDF export; we own the upload queue. SLA: 4-hour response on rendering failures. Escalate only after two failed retries. Their support desk is reachable at the address below.

billing contact of hahaf-baguf = zorael.tammir.jorius@sivrelhq.internal